About the Role

Laurel’s Business Technology team is dedicated to providing reliable, secure, and easy-to-use technology for our employees. This role is crucial for managing our internal IT environment — operating at the intersection of platform, AI, and internal systems. You are the technical anchor for how the company connects systems, automates internal workflows, and embeds intelligent capabilities into the company's infrastructure.

What You’ll Do

IT Operations & Infrastructure

  • Own the architecture and technical strategy for internal automation systems — defining how the company's tech stack (HRIS, Okta, Salesforce, and others) connects, scales, and stays maintainable

  • Architect and manage cloud-based infrastructure (AWS, GCP, or Azure) — including compute, networking, storage, and security

  • Design and automate onboarding/offboarding workflows, including provisioning and deprovisioning access

  • Own the architecture and lifecycle of internal AI tooling (e.g. Vercel, Supabase, Claude, ChatGPT— from evaluation through deployment, access governance, and deprecation

  • Ensure proper access controls, least-privilege principles, and audit readiness across systems

  • Establish CI/CD standards and error-handling patterns for automation systems so they're reliable, observable, and maintainable at scale

What We're Looking For

The following are our non-negotiables for candidates.

Core Requirements

  • 7+ years of experience managing corporate IT infrastructure in a modern, cloud-first environment

  • Demonstrated experience building or operating AI-powered systems — including evaluating LLM tooling, managing AI infrastructure, and thinking critically about reliability, cost, and governance tradeoffs

  • Strong experience with Workato or similar IPaaS solution, MacOS, and managing Okta or similar IDP platforms

  • Clear judgment, architectural thinking, and the ability to drive complex systems

  • Proven experience managing SaaS ecosystems and identity lifecycle (onboarding/offboarding)

  • Experience working in high-growth or startup environments

  • Excellent stakeholder engagement and communication skills
